Welsh Greens' 'strategic decision' on candidates

Welsh Greens have taken a decision to not put forward some candidates for the general election for "strategic reasons", leader Grenville Ham has said.

The party has only ten candidates in Wales at the 8 June poll.

The Wales Green Party leader Mr Ham said a further ten had been picked, but said reasons such as money or to show support for other parties, local parties decided to "withdraw".

He spoke to BBC Wales political reporter Carl Roberts at the launch of the Welsh Green Party's election manifesto.
